Overview of Digital Image Watermarking
Abstract
Digital media especially image can be copied flawlessly and distributed over the internet. Intellectual property
rights of the digital media are misused. Digital watermarking is consider as a possible solution, basically,a digital watermark
is adding some kind of information like copyright information, owner name, logo etc.in digital image. In this review paper,
we gave some information regarding the digital watermarking. Digital watermark of an image can be visible and invisible.
The watermark can be inserted in the pixel level i.e. spatial domain using the technique like Least Significant Bit substitution
or patchwork algorithm or in frequency domain i.e. transform domain by modifying the corresponding coefficient after the
transformation. The uses of a watermark is being discussed in brief in this paper and most importantly some of the
attacksregarding digital watermarking are also mentioned in the presented paper. We also gave the theoretical background of
image transform such as Discrete Cosine Transform, Discrete Wavelet Transform, Discrete Fourier Transform and discuss
the advantage and disadvantage each transform regarding image watermarking are also discussed.
